Eswin Marco LOPEZ DE LEON Petitioner v. Monty WILKINSON, Acting Attorney General of the United States 1 Respondent
[Unpublished]
Guatemalan native and citizen Eswin Marco Lopez De Leon petitions for review of an order of the Board of Immigration Appeals (BIA) denying his motion to reopen his removal proceedings. Upon careful consideration of his challenges to the BIA's order, we find no abuse of discretion in the denial of his untimely filed motion to reopen. See Clifton v Holder, 598 F.3d 486, 490-91 (8th Cir. 2010) (standard of review). The petition for review is denied.
PER CURIAM.
